I already have another Aluratek radio and I was quite surprised when the one I got refused to connect to my network. After several of the usual stupid questions from tech support, the technician turned out to be really helpful. Unfortunately, my unit also suffered from power drop-outs when I moved it gently, so I requested a replacement from Amazon -- and got it within 48 hrs. (Amazing, Amazon!)
The new unit wouldn't connect either, but the technician again walked me through several options and we discovered that the problem was because I had two routers using the same SSID and password. I changed one SSID and the Aluratek has been wirelessly playing the contents of my media server ever since.
